NFL Week 16 action continues with a matchup between the Jacksonville Jaguars and Las Vegas Raiders. Neither team are doing great this season nor will they make it to the playoffs. The Jaguars are at 3-11 in the AFC South and the Raiders are at 2-12 in the AFC West.

On Sunday, Dec. 15, the Jaguars lost to the New York Jets 32-25 and on Monday, Dec. 16, the Raiders lost to the Atlanta Falcons with a final score of 15-9. Both teams are eliminated from the playoffs.


You May Also Like

When is Jaguars vs. Raiders?

Jacksonville Jaguars vs. Las Vegas Raiders takes place at 4:25 p.m. ET on Dec. 22. The two teams will face off at Allegiant Stadium in Paradise, Nevada.

The game will air on CBS, where Andrew Catalon is expected to do the play-by-play. Tiki Barber and Jason McCourty will join him in the booth. AJ Ross will be the sideline reporter.
